Yes. Karl runs off your outdoor tap by default, but he carries his own tank and connections for jobs where the tap is too far, too low-pressure, or doesn't exist. Just flag it on the quote so he turns up with the right setup.
Usually yes, but Karl checks first. Painted, sealed, or stained concrete can react badly to high pressure if the surface is already tired. He'll adjust the pressure, distance, and tip, or recommend not blasting that section if it'll do more harm than good.
If you're not sure what the surface is, send a photo. Better to over-share than re-do.
A single driveway is usually 1 to 2 hours. Driveway + path + patio in one visit is half a day. A fence is half a day to a full day depending on length and condition. Whole-section jobs run a full day. Karl confirms the time window when he books you in.
Karl needs a working outdoor tap and a power outlet he can plug the waterblaster into. If you have an outdoor power point, you don't have to be home, just leave access open and he'll sort the job and send photos.
If there's no outdoor power point, someone needs to either be home to let him plug into an inside one, or run an extension lead out a window, security door, cat door, or garage door, and leave it switched on at the wall. From there Karl uses his own extension leads to reach the rest of the section. A lot of people set that up before they head off to work.
